Output d8bd0b5d38b74c39c1e7ed91d7d0ed3216005aeb6bc6953e2e5110973f5384fe:1

value
71330352
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de76fd2a2c1fc7e305c913c0dc3b21847533d384 OP_EQUALVERIFY OP_CHECKSIG
address
1MHHZ5k7yUD7HrhggWMhoLriY8AFECH2bq
transaction
d8bd0b5d38b74c39c1e7ed91d7d0ed3216005aeb6bc6953e2e5110973f5384fe
confirmations
430594
spent
true